Habibul Hossain Kohel Joins El Madridista Chittagong

Habibul Hossain Kohel’s move from Comilla Conquerors to El Madridista Chittagong gives the club a clear transfer upgrade in a role that matters. Listed as the main shirt number 10, he arrives with a profile that fits the creative demands of a team looking to sharpen its attack and improve control in the final third. For El Madridista Chittagong, this is not just a normal squad change. It is a signing that adds identity, balance, and a trusted central option in the build-up phase.

The transfer angle becomes stronger when the ranking data is added. El Madridista Chittagong’s all-time record shows Rank #4652, with 76 played, 28 wins, 18 draws, 129 goals, 181 points, and a 49% win rate. That history suggests a side with real competitive value and a proven ability to stay involved in results over time. The 2026 season ranking, however, shows more work to do: Rank #7230, 21 played, 7 wins, 3 draws, 31 goals, 37 points, and a 40% win rate. Those numbers point to a team that can score, but still needs more consistency and better control across matches. A player like Kohel fits that need because a number 10 is often the link between midfield and attack, the player who helps turn possession into clear chances.
